Hello,

PayPal Express checkout is not appearing for the customers.
I am sure that I have it set up properly, Website Payments Standard & Direct are both working.

Do I need to configure it by setting-up a separate Gateway method ?
i configured the gateway method and checked all payment method types including the paypal.

And when I try to add another Gateway " in-case that selecting all payment types in a single gateway is wrong !! "
and by following-up the Ablecommerce Help, there is a step where i must choose the Paypal button:
1.From the Payment Gateways page, click the ADD GATEWAY button.
2.From the Add Gateway page, click the "PAYPAL" button.

And I cant find this button, there is only "PAYPAL PAYFLOW PRO" Button !!

PayPal Express Checkout does not appear on the checkout page with the other payment options. Instead, in the mini-basket sidebar, a PayPal express button should appear right below your normal checkout button. You do not need to configure a seperate gateway, as it will use the PayPal gateway you already have configured for Website Payments Standard/Direct.

As a side note, you won't see the option to add the PayPal gateway if you already have the PayPal gateway configured.

In addition to the previous post... you will also need to get the API's from PayPal and have them filled out in your PayPal Gateway if you have not already.

Also, from my past experience when I set up PayPal in AC for others, I only check the PAPAL method at the bottom of the page if my client is using V/MC etc with another 3rd party payment processing center. They have another gateway to handle those credit card payments.
